
MySql
Mysql
落花流水6
这个作者很懒,什么都没留下…
展开
-
mysql基本操作语法
//创建数据库create database t_sys;//实例化数据库use t_sys;//创建部门表create table t_dept( p_id int primary key auto_increment not null, --主键自增 p_name varchar(20) not null);//查询部门表结构原创 2015-05-30 15:56:14 · 567 阅读 · 0 评论 -
修复MySQL中损坏的表
阐述: 在mysql中有时会表损坏打不开,此时我们可以用的pepair table语句对表进行修复。1.SQL语法:repair table 表名;2.返回参数列表:参考:http://dev.yesky.com/442/33946442.shtml原创 2016-12-13 17:57:25 · 747 阅读 · 0 评论 -
查看数据库中所有表详细信息
1.查看数据库中所有表的状态信息show table status;2.查看数据库中所有表的更新时间SELECT TABLE_NAME,UPDATE_TIME FROM information_schema.tables where TABLE_SCHEMA=‘数据库名称’原创 2016-12-13 10:07:14 · 4052 阅读 · 0 评论 -
MySQL数据加密与解密
1.创建表,密码字段必须是32位,不然,插入数据进行MD5加密时,此字段不能加密。表结构:2.在表中插入数据,u_pwd表字段进行MD5加密。SQL语句:insert into t_user(p_id,u_name,u_pwd,u_age) values(1,'zxx',MD5('123456'),26);原创 2016-12-13 09:57:11 · 2597 阅读 · 1 评论 -
Mysql中查询databases中多少张表及所有表名
1.查询database中所有表名,SQL语句:select table_name from information_schema.tables where table_schema='数据库名';select table_name from information_schema.tables where table_schema='test';2.查询databa原创 2016-12-10 14:50:08 · 1220 阅读 · 0 评论 -
查看mysql中database占用磁盘空间的大小SQL语句
1.选择information_schemause information_schema2.查询所有database占用磁盘空间大小select TABLE_SCHEMA, concat(truncate(sum(data_length)/1024/1024,2),' MB') as data_size,concat(truncate(sum(index_length)/1024/102原创 2016-10-11 15:21:18 · 6600 阅读 · 0 评论 -
MySQL表字段的创建、删除、修改操作
mysql表字段的添加、删除、修改...原创 2016-04-11 20:20:48 · 614 阅读 · 0 评论 -
mysql中索引
一、概述1、What? 索引是对数据库表中一列或多列的值进行排序的的一种结构,可以提高数据库中特定的数据查询速度。 索引时一个单独存储在磁盘上的数据库结构,包括对数据表里面的所有记录的引用指针。 索引时在存储引擎中实现的,每种存储引擎的索引都不一定相同,也不一定支持所有索引类型,msyql中索引存储类型有两种:btree、hash,具体和表的存储引擎相关的:myisam、InnoD原创 2016-08-22 20:56:54 · 487 阅读 · 0 评论 -
window无法启动Mysql服务(位于本地计算机)上
一、启动mysql服务时,出现window无法启动Mysql(位于本地计算机)上,如下:二、解决办法我本机上面,出现这样的错误,是由于mysql安装路径不一致而导致,才出现此问题。1、打开dos窗口,定位到mysql安装目录下面的bin文件夹里面,如下:2、安装mysql服务,注意,一定是mysql安装所在的目录。mysqld --install三、my原创 2016-06-11 19:47:12 · 5448 阅读 · 0 评论 -
MySQL中出现用ip连接错误解决办法
1.Navicat连接去用ip连接MySQL服务会出现错误,如下:Host is blocked because of many connection errors; unblock with 'mysqladmin flush-hosts'原因:同一个ip在短时间内产生太多(超过mysql数据库max_connection_errors的最大值)中断的数据库连接而导致的阻塞;原创 2017-04-19 19:50:12 · 4324 阅读 · 0 评论